The Mystical Path of Islam

Diana Steigerwald

Religious Studies, California State University (Long Beach)

 

Reference: “The Mystical Path of Islam” in Mysticism: Select Essays: Essays in Honour of John Sahadat, pp. 231-263. Melchior Mbonimpa, Guy Bonneau, Kenneth-Roy Bonin ed. Sudbury (Canada): Editions Glopro, 2002.

 

 

Abstract: In this chapter, we do not claim to be exhaustive, we wish to briefly introduce the reader to essential Sûfî concepts by examining the following topics: i) the mystical roots of the Qur’ân, ii) mystical sayings attributed to Muhammad, iii) Muhammad's night journey, iv) an historical survey of some great Sûfîs, and v) some Sûfî orders.
